Abstract

High-power broad-area diode lasers (BALs) generate significant heat, impacting performance. A 2+1 dimensional traveling wave (TW) model incorporates heating effects through an iterative coupling of electro-optical (EO) and heat-transport (HT) solvers. This method analyzes heat sources, temperature profiles, and thermally induced refractive index changes.
